More Than 30 U.S. Federal Government Organizations Have Deployed
Ascential Software Solutions to Improve Security and Contain Costs
Federal Customers Include Departments of Homeland Security,
Justice, Treasury, and Agriculture WESTBORO, Mass., Jan. 18
/P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Ascential Software Corporation
(NASDAQ:ASCL), the enterprise data integration leader, is helping
more than 30 U.S. Federal Government organizations -- including The
Department of Homeland Security, The Food and Drug Administration,
The Defense Information Systems Agency, and The Defense Logistics
Agency -- improve operational performance and help reduce program
costs by enhancing the accuracy and timeliness of data critical to
security operations. "The Federal Government is dealing with the
most challenging data integration and analysis requirements that
you will find in any environment," said Mark Forman, EVP of
worldwide services at Cassatt (an Ascential Software partner), and
former CIO of the Federal Government. "In order to fulfill Homeland
Security, military, and social services functions, government
employees have to be able to rapidly access and analyze large
volumes of high quality information. We believe Cassatt's
partnership with Ascential Software helps meet these requirements
key to federal e-government and IT modernization efforts."
"On-demand information sharing within and between government
organizations is increasingly important as Federal institutions
move to reduce the cost of government, improve service, and enhance
national security," said Bill Smith, director of Ascential
Software's Federal division. "The Ascential Enterprise Integration
Suite(TM) provides the core integration and data quality
capabilities required to address the data management issues facing
many government entities today, as they move forward with
mission-critical information sharing initiatives." Accurate,
real-time information sharing among government agencies is crucial
to generating cost efficiencies and streamlining a broad range of
military and civilian operations. Many government agencies and
departments are looking to Ascential Software to meet the
requirements for secure, comprehensive integration of massive
quantities of data in mixed computing environments. Ascential
Software's Federal customers include the: * Defense Information
Systems Agency * Defense Logistics Agency * Department of the Air
Force * Department of Agriculture * Department of the Army *
Department of Homeland Security * Department of Justice *
Department of the Navy * Department of the Treasury * Food and Drug
Administration * General Services Agency Ascential Software
